Gunmen shot dead youth In Sopore

Srinagar, June 6: Unknown gunmen shot dead a youth in Bomai village of Sopore in north Kashmir’s Baramulla district on Saturday. Official sources said that unknown gunmen this evening fired upon one Danish Nazir Najar near Edipora, Bomai in Zainageer, injuring him critically. Covid-19 Claims four lives in a day, J&K death toll reaches 40

Srinagar, Jun 6: Four more COVID-19 deaths were reported in Jammu and Kashmir on Saturday, taking the total number of fatalities due to the virus in the J&K to 40, officials said.
